Output 5c2fa7d9944c79ce9bd8bbe1916d1e3b2ce14a7a21dffeb4afdd2ecac19d7f71:2

value
889374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b264285c8e1aeebaaab6138ecd0d719e150c68 OP_EQUAL
address
3MzXdyG62UFcxM7xR3eWqCBFKYXsbjyMNp
transaction
5c2fa7d9944c79ce9bd8bbe1916d1e3b2ce14a7a21dffeb4afdd2ecac19d7f71
spent
true